DCRPC Demographic information consists of the most recent Decennial Census Summary File 1 (DP-1) for Population and Housing Characteristics by Jurisdiction in Delaware County,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ates (ACS data) for the County (Census Bureau), most recent Population Estimates, (Census Bureau 7/2018), Build-out Population Projections by Jurisdiction completed by DCRPC, New Construction Building Permits since 1981 (by jurisdiction), and Population Projections to 2040 (by jurisdiction and school district). The 2018 ACS 5-Year data provided the information for Delaware County (and Townships and Incorporated Areas) including DP02 (Social Characteristics), DP03 (Economic Characteristics), DP04 (Housing Characteristics), and DP05 (Demographic and Housing).


Current Trends

Delaware County was the 22nd fastest-growing county in the USA by percentage of growth according to the 2010 Decennial Census, and was #87 in the fastest-growing counties in the US according to the Census Bureau’s population estimates from 4/2010 to 7/2018 with 17.6% growth added 30,654 people to a total of 204,826.

Delaware County is also the No. 1 fastest-growing county in the state of Ohio whether in the 2010 Decennial Census, the Census Estimate between 2010 and 2018, and also No. 1 between 7/2017 to 7/2018.

Between 4/2000 and 4/2010, the growth rate of Central Ohio (13.96%) was higher than the United States (9.71%) and the State of Ohio (1.62%), as well as other metropolitan areas in Ohio. From 2013 to 2014, Ohio experienced the highest annual growth rate compared to the previous three years.

Since 1970, the population growth rate of Franklin County was been lower than the overall growth rate of Central Ohio. This suggests that the growth has spread out over Central Ohio beginning at about that point. Therefore, the RPC used the population data for the last 40 years to figure projections for the Step-Down method.

According to the population estimates by the Census Bureau, Delaware County experienced a 1.98% (average annual growth rate) in population from 7/2010 to 7/2018, which is lower than the average annual growth rate between 2000 and 2010 (4.71%).
